Transaction 8c918139f43d91b69b124a80f75c62802171b0c88ee8b81b49b0b3623f65f7e5

4 Input
2 Outputs
  • 8c918139f43d91b69b124a80f75c62802171b0c88ee8b81b49b0b3623f65f7e5:0
  • value  52100
    address  1DvwKSx9MHkUjWHRKdvGCrmfticNBCupLX
  • 8c918139f43d91b69b124a80f75c62802171b0c88ee8b81b49b0b3623f65f7e5:1
  • value  865337
    address  3JWPjeEMNwkdxDpErhDYLkeKvcZt6Sgimw